Use the following data for the next questions. Biologists, researching the effects
of adding limestone sand as buffer for acid rain effects in streams, monitored the
pH levels of two streams each month for 36 months. The first stream had a mean
pH level of 6.8 with a standard deviation of 2.3. The control stream had a mean pH
level of 9.2 with a standard deviation of 1.5. Assume a .05 significance level for
testing the claim that the mean pH of the first stream was less (more acidic) than
the mean pH of the control stream. Also, assume the two samples are independent
simple random samples selected from normally distributed populations.
-Test the given claim using the traditional or P-value method for hypothesis testing about two means. Do not assume that the population standard deviations are equal. Identify the null hypothesis and alternative hypothesis, state a conclusion about the null hypothesis, and state a final conclusion that addresses the original claim.
